How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Sunmor?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Sunmor Studio Apartments | $1,745 | $1,362 | $2,327 |
Sunmor 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,978 | $1,323 | $3,415 |
Sunmor 2 Bedroom Apartments | $2,262 | $1,699 | $3,311 |
Sunmor 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,408 | $2,341 | $2,575 |

Getting Around the Sunmor Neighborhood in Palm Springs, CA
Walk Score®
27 / 100
Car-Dependent
Most errands require a car
Bike Score®
47 / 100
Somewhat Bikeable
Minimal bike infrastructure
Transit Score®
31 / 100
Some Transit
A few nearby public transportation options
